What is a Research Problem?

A research problem is a specific issue, difficulty, contradiction, or gap in knowledge that a researcher aims to address through systematic investigation. It forms the basis of a study, guiding the research question, research design, and the formulation of a hypothesis.

Characteristics of a Research Problem

  1. Clarity: The research problem should be clearly defined, unambiguous, and understandable to all stakeholders.
  2. Specificity: It should be specific and narrow enough to be addressed comprehensively within the scope of the research.
  3. Relevance: The problem should be significant and relevant to the field of study, contributing to the advancement of knowledge or practice.
  4. Feasibility: It should be practical and manageable, considering the resources, time, and capabilities available to the researcher.
  5. Novelty: The research problem should address an original question or gap in the existing literature, providing new insights or perspectives.
  6. Researchability: The problem should be researchable using scientific methods, including data collection, analysis, and interpretation.
  7. Ethical Considerations: The research problem should be ethically sound, ensuring no harm to participants or the environment.
  8. Alignment with Objectives: The problem should align with the research objectives and goals, guiding the direction and purpose of the study.
  9. Measurability: It should be possible to measure and evaluate the outcomes related to the problem using appropriate metrics and methodologies.
  10. Contextualization: The problem should be placed within a broader context, considering theoretical frameworks, existing literature, and practical applications.

Types of Research Problems

  1. Descriptive Research Problems:
    • Aim: To describe the characteristics of a specific phenomenon or population.
    • Example: “What are the key features of successful online education programs?”
  2. Comparative Research Problems:
    • Aim: To compare two or more groups, variables, or phenomena.
    • Example: “How does employee satisfaction differ between remote and on-site workers?”
  3. Causal Research Problems:
    • Aim: To determine cause-and-effect relationships between variables.
    • Example: “What is the impact of leadership style on employee productivity?”
  4. Relational Research Problems:
    • Aim: To examine the relationship between two or more variables.
    • Example: “What is the relationship between social media usage and self-esteem among teenagers?”
  5. Exploratory Research Problems:
    • Aim: To explore a new or under-researched area where little information is available.
    • Example: “What are the emerging trends in consumer behavior post-pandemic?”
  6. Applied Research Problems:
    • Aim: To solve a specific, practical problem faced by an organization or society.
    • Example: “How can small businesses improve their cybersecurity measures?”
  7. Theoretical Research Problems:
    • Aim: To expand existing theories or develop new theoretical frameworks.
    • Example: “How can existing theories of motivation be integrated to better understand employee behavior?”
  8. Policy-Oriented Research Problems:
    • Aim: To evaluate the effects of policies or suggest improvements.
    • Example: “What are the effects of the new minimum wage laws on small businesses?”
  9. Ethical Research Problems:
    • Aim: To investigate ethical issues within a field or practice.
    • Example: “What are the ethical implications of AI in decision-making processes?”
  10. Interdisciplinary Research Problems:
    • Aim: To address issues that span multiple disciplines or fields of study.
    • Example: “How can principles of environmental science and economics be combined to develop sustainable business practices?”

How to Define a Research Problem

Defining a research problem involves several key steps that help in identifying and articulating a specific issue that needs investigation. Here’s a structured approach:

  1. Identify a Broad Topic:
    • Choose a general area of interest or field relevant to your expertise or curiosity. This can be broad initially and will be narrowed down through the next steps.
  2. Conduct a Literature Review:
    • Review existing research to understand what has already been studied. This helps in identifying gaps, inconsistencies, or areas that need further exploration.
  3. Narrow Down the Topic:
    • Based on your literature review, refine your broad topic to a more specific issue or aspect that has not been adequately addressed.
  4. Consider Practical Relevance:
    • Ensure the problem is significant and relevant to the field. It should address a real-world issue or theoretical gap that contributes to advancing knowledge or solving practical problems.
  5. Formulate the Problem Statement:
    • Clearly articulate the problem in a concise and precise manner. This statement should explain what the problem is, why it is important, and how it impacts the field.
  6. Define the Research Questions:
    • Develop specific research questions that your study will answer. These questions should be directly related to your problem statement and guide the direction of your research.
  7. Set Objectives and Hypotheses:
    • Establish clear research objectives that outline what you aim to achieve. Formulate hypotheses if applicable, which are testable predictions related to your research questions.
  8. Assess Feasibility:
    • Consider the resources, time, and scope of your study. Ensure that the research problem you have defined is feasible to investigate within the constraints you have.
  9. Seek Feedback:
    • Discuss your defined research problem with peers, mentors, or experts in the field. Feedback can help refine and improve your problem statement.
